The investigation of the effect of humeral head depressor muscle co-activation training on functional outcomes in patients undergoing arthroscopic shoulder surgery after medium-sized rotator cuff muscle tear

Özet (EN)
Several clinical trials have investigated the effects of the humeral head depressor muscle co-activation training on glenohumeral joint dysfunction. However, evidence is still lacking to support the efficacy of this program for the patients undergoing arthroscopic rotator cuff repair (ARCR) after medium-sized rotator cuff (RC) muscle tear. In this context, the aim of this study was to evaluate the effects of humeral head depressor muscle co-activation training on functional outcomes in patients undergoing ARCR after medium-sized RC muscle tear. Twenty-seven individuals were included in this study. One participant was excluded from the study before randomization. A total of twenty-six participants were randomly divided into two groups as the treatment group (n=13) and control group (n=13). Conservative training of both groups were conducted by the same researcher. In addition to the conservative program, humeral head depressor muscle co-activation training for teres major, latissimus dorsi and pectoralis major muscles was performed for the treatment group. The EMG-Biofeedback (Chattanooga Group Inc., Chattanooga, TN), a neuromuscular-based training tool, was used for co-activation training. Co-activation of these muscles was requested during glenohumeral joint exercises. Participants were assessed in terms of pain (Visual Analog Scale), range of motion (Universal Goniometer), and functional scores (Disabilities of the Arm, Shoulder, and Hand Questionnaire; Revised Oxford Shoulder Score; Modified Constant-Murley Score; Western Ontario Rotator Cuff Index) both pre- and post-treatment blindly to the groups. Due to the some problems during the follow-up period, 24 participants were analyzed. Both programs were found to be effective in the intra-group comparisons in terms of all measurements (p<.05). In terms of time and group*time interactions, the improvement in examined variables were greater in the treatment group compared to the control group except internal rotation range of motion (p<.05). Humeral head depressor muscle co-activation training is an effective choice in the treatment of the patients undergoing ARCR after medium-sized RC muscle tear according to the results of this study. Decrease of net abduction torque and increase of glenohumeral contact force improve functional scores.
